Responsibilities

  • Help process/optimize art assets for efficient use in the game engine.
  • Under the supervision of technical and VFX artists: create models, textures, material setups/UV layouts, and some look development for environment/prop assets, including LODs.
  • Under the supervision of VFX artists, create high-quality, optimized visual effects using animation, procedural simulation, dynamic simulation, and particle and fluid systems.
  • Learn real‐time art workflow in the immersive experience production context.
  • Learn features/functions in Unreal Engine 5 and third‐party tools. Create art examples using these tools and create effective presentations showing findings and results.
  • Setting up and organizing project files, including cleaning up references and folders to align with established protocols.
  • Under supervision of technical/VFX artists, perform scripting tasks and gain experience in:
  • Game design scripting
  • Small tools scripting
  • Unreal 5 plug‐ins
  • Blueprints
  • Python
  • Shaders
  • Niagara
  • Houdini
